Ensure your web APIs are consistent and bug-free by implementing an automated testing process.
In Testing Web APIs you will:
Design and implement a web API testing strategy
Set up a test automation suite
Learn contract testing with Pact
Facilitate collaborative discussions to test web API designs
Perform exploratory tests
Experiment safely in a downloadable API sandbox environment
Testing Web APIs teaches you to plan and implement the perfect testing strategy for your web APIs. In it, you’ll explore dozens of different testing activities to help you develop a custom testing regime for your projects. This practical book demystifies abstract strategic concepts by applying them to common API testing scenarios, revealing how these complex ideas work in the real world. You’ll learn to take a risk-driven approach to API testing, and build a strategy that goes beyond the basics of code and requirements coverage. Your whole team will soon be involved in ensuring quality!
Purchase of the print book includes a free eBook in PDF, Kindle, and ePub formats from Manning Publications.
About the technology
Web APIs are the public face of your application, and they need to be perfect. Implementing an automated testing program is the best way to ensure that your web APIs are production ready.
About the book
Testing Web APIs is a unique and practical guide, from the initial design of your testing suite through techniques for documentation, implementation, and delivery of consistently excellent APIs. You’ll see a wide range of testing techniques, from exploratory to live testing of production code, and how to save time with automation using industry-standard tools. This book helps take the hassle out of API testing.
What's inside
Design and implement a web API testing strategy
Set up a test automation suite
Contract testing with Pact
Hands-on practice in the downloadable API sandbox
About the reader
For dedicated software QA and testers, or experienced developers. Examples in Java.
About the author
Mark Winteringham is the OpsBoss at Ministry of Testing, where he teaches many aspects of software testing.
Table of Contents
PART 1 THE VALUE OF WEB API TESTING
1 Why and how we test web APIs
2 Beginning our testing journey
3 Quality and risk
PART 2 BEGINNING OUR TEST STRATEGY
4 Testing API designs
5 Exploratory testing APIs
6 Automating web API tests
7 Establishing and implementing a testing strategy
PART 3 EXPANDING OUR TEST STRATEGY
8 Advanced web API automation
9 Contract testing
10 Performance testing
11 Security testing
12 Testing in production
